What the petition asks
Trans people from around the UK do not have enough protection put in place by the government, and trans rights are currently being threatened to a worrying extent.
Almost half (48 per cent) of trans people in Britain have attempted suicide at least once; 84 per cent have thought about it. More than half (55 per cent) have been diagnosed with depression at some point. This is worsened by the government not giving enough support and protection to trans people across the UK and this should be a priority for them. Action to help trans people will help to start to bring these numbers down.
Why it was rejected
It was not clear what the petition asked the UK Government or Parliament to do.
Petitions need to call on the Government or Parliament to take a specific action. We're not sure exactly what you'd like the Government or Parliament to do.
We understand that you're concerned about the rights of trans people, but under the Equality Act 2010 it is already unlawful to discriminate against someone because they are transsexual: https://www.equalityhumanrights.com/en/advice-and-guidance/gender-reassignment-discrimination
You could start a new petition explaining clearly what you would like the Government or Parliament to do.
